Understanding the Need for Enhanced Insulation

Insulation quality significantly affects electrical system reliability. Aging insulation can lead to short circuits, downtime, and safety hazards. The introduction of advanced technology, like the Spindle for Pin Insulators, promises to mitigate these issues effectively.

What is a Spindle for Pin Insulator?

A Spindle for Pin Insulator is a specialized component designed to enhance the durability and efficiency of electrical insulation systems. Made with high-performance materials, these spindles offer superior strength and resistance to environmental factors compared to traditional options.

4. What materials are spindle for pin insulators made from?

They are typically constructed from high-strength composites and ceramics designed to withstand extreme conditions and pressures, ensuring longevity and reliability.

5. How often should insulators be inspected or replaced?

Routine inspections should be conducted annually, while the replacement schedule can vary based on the type of insulator used and environmental conditions, typically every 10-15 years for traditional materials.
